debian/control -------------- - The VCS-* fields should be relative to the debian packaging, not the upstream repository. From what I've seen, this source package has been generated from the upstream "debian/" subdirectory. This is misleading because you can't easily export a tarball and use it as a .orig file. As you are the upstream author, I suggest that you use a single source package to build these two binary packages (one .dsc, two .debs). That should ease maintenance, including the following point. - The dependency against lebiniou-data is not versioned. That means that lebiniou is meant to be usable with any version of lebiniou-data. In such a case I think you need to specify exactly one version. With a single source package, you could depend on lebinou-data (= ${source:Version}).
